Why

Sixteen German states, the KMK, Austria, Zürich, Luxembourg and the US Common Core each publish their own standards, and none of them as data. Teachers can't compare competencies across borders. Publishers can't map content to standards programmatically. International frameworks like CASE exist, but nobody has applied them to these curricula.

currikon fixes this by providing a single, structured, searchable API that spans jurisdictions and countries — with cross-state mappings powered by national standards.

What

  • 21 official curricula — 16 German states, KMK, Austria, Zürich, Luxembourg and the US Common Core
  • Cross-jurisdiction mappings via LLM-assisted alignment to national standards
  • CASE v1.1 export for international interoperability
  • Full-text search with SQLite FTS5 + AI-powered alignment
  • TypeScript SDK with full type safety and autocomplete
